У меня есть веб-страница, которую пользователь может выбрать из множества вариантов и перейти на страницу. Я могу обработать это с помощью req.query.var, но когда пользователь нажимает на следующую страницу, я также должен добавить параметр, который пользователь сначала выбрал, в противном случаеоткрывается страница со случайным контентом.Как я могу сохранить опцию, которую пользователь сначала выбрал, и передать ее при следующей передаче кнопки, когда он хочет перейти на следующую страницу?
app.get('/mypage', function(req, res){
var page = req.query.page;
var sort = req.query.sort;
var url = 'url' + sort + 'url' + page;
request(url, function(error, response, body){
if(!error && response.statusCode == 200){
var func= JSON.parse(body);
res.render('mypage.ejs', {func: func});
}
});
Таким образом, я могу перенаправить пользователя на страницу свыбор сортировки, но когда они находятся на странице и щелкают по следующей странице, мне нужен способ передать предварительно выбранную сортировку со следующей отправкой кнопки, которая является
<form action="/mypage" method="GET">
<input type="hidden" name="page" value='<%= func["page"] + 1 %>'>
<input class="input" type="submit" value="next page">
</form>